Design And Application Of The Questionnaire On English Learning Anxiety Of College Students

Foreign language learning anxiety, as one of an important language learning factors, is a peculiar phenomenon in language learning process, and has caused great concerns to the researchers. Meanwhile, the anxiety in English listening, speaking, reading and writing, which are regarded as the four basic English skills, has gained increasing attention. College students, as high-educated ones, also have English learning anxiety. Therefore, on the basis of sorting out the related concepts and theories, this study aims to design a questionnaire on English learning anxiety, which is suitable for Chinese college students. This questionnaire is composed of four parts, including listening, speaking, reading and writing anxiety. The last part is the formal application of this questionnaire, and there are more than one thousand students from the three universities in Dalian taking part in it. The results are as follows:The first is the organization of the four sub-questionnaire on English Learning Anxiety. Listening sub-questionnaire includes three factors, the anxiety in listening class, communication, and test. Speaking sub-questionnaire also contains three factors, the anxiety in speaking class, communication, and test. While, there are two factors in reading sub-questionnaire, including reading test anxiety and general reading anxiety. Writing sub-questionnaire comprises three factors, the anxiety of evaluation, regulation and digressing to the topic.The second is that this questionnaire on learning English anxiety has a good reliability and validity, and the index of the model fit is normal. This indicates that the structure of the questionnaire is stable, and it can be used as the measuring tool on English learning anxiety for college students. The third is that the students have anxiety in the English English listening, speaking, reading and writing to some extend, and the differences of anxiety show in different genders and different grades in college. However, there is no differences in different majors. There is a negative correlation between English learning anxiety and English achievements, and the significant negative correlation in statistics is found between English writing anxiety and English writing performance.
